Pedalboard-ready Convolution Reverb with Onboard IR Cloning

Equipped with two cutting-edge engines, the Hotone Verbera convolution reverb pedal will round out your sonic arsenal with both stunning impulse response reverbs and more traditional algorithm-based echoes. This stereo pedal boasts 120 premium IRs right out of the box, capturing the complex resonance of symphony halls, cathedrals, and more. What’s more, plenty of legendary hardware reverb patches augment these regal real-world IRs — you can even capture the sounds of your favorite reverb pedals and hardware using the Verbera’s onboard cloning function! These ’verbs can be layered and tweaked utilizing the pedal’s intuitive LCD-based workflow, with power parameter controls, optional tails, and real-time IR envelope adjustment/switching. You also get a plethora of performance-minded appointments, including MIDI control, an expression pedal input, dual footswitch modes, and an ethereal Freeze function. It’s all topped off with studio-grade ultra-low-latency performance, a pure analog dry-through circuit design, superb AD/DA conversion with 32-bit/192kHz sampling accuracy, and a USB jack for straightforward firmware updates and preset management.

Innovative dual-engine construction

The key to the Hotone Verbera’s versatility lies in its powerhouse dual-engine design. It all starts with a cutting-edge IR convolution engine, which captures the natural echoes and reflections of real-world spaces and studio gear with the utmost accuracy. Just this engine on its own would make for a formidable echo box, yet Hotone ups the ante even further with the Verbera’s finely tuned algorithmic reverb engine. Best of all, these two engines can be layered, shaped, and sculpted to your heart’s content, giving you the power to dial in wholly distinct reverb resonations to set your sound apart.

Clone your entire reverb collection

Right out of the gate, the Hotone Verbera comes packed with 120 IRs, with the ability to save up to 1,024. To fill out those extra spaces, the Verbera comes equipped with a powerful IR cloning engine that digitally captures the sounds of hardware reverb pedals and effects with stunning sonic precision. Slap a Verbera onto your pedalboard, and you'll be able to effortlessly access all your favorite ’verbs from a single stompbox!

Note: The Hotone Verbera’s cloning function operates off impulse response technology and cannot clone shimmer/effect-laden reverb patches.

Hotone Verbera Features:

  • Dual-engine convolution reverb pedal, loaded with 120 professional-grade IRs of real-world spaces and legendary hardware
  • Onboard IR cloning gives you the power to create digital replicas of your favorite reverb pedals and effects
  • Stereo inputs and outputs with selectable input modes to accommodate any rig
  • Supports spacious reverb tails of up to 20 seconds (10 seconds in stereo) with ultra-low-latency performance
  • Seamless IR switching and real-time IR envelope modification ensures a smooth and intuitive workflow
  • Packed with reverb parameters to tweak your sound, including Attack, Tone, Pre-delay, and Mod
  • LCD screen provides effortless navigation of your presets and parameters
  • Sports an expression pedal input and MIDI functionality to supply enhanced control
  • Dual footswitch modes available for standard bypass operation, preset switching, and the pedal’s ethereal Freeze function
  • Stores up to 1,024 IRs and up to 200 presets
  • Premium-quality build from top to bottom, including high-performance AD/DA conversion with 32-bit/192kHz sampling accuracy and a pure analog dry-through circuit
  • USB allows for firmware updates and preset/IR management via Hotone’s proprietary PC/MAC software

Tech Specs

  • Pedal Type: Reverb
  • Presets: Up to 200
  • Inputs: 1 x 1/4"
  • Outputs: 2 x 1/4"
  • MIDI I/O: In/Thru
  • USB: 1 x USB-C
  • Power Source: 9V DC power supply
  • Height: 2.46"
  • Width: 4.94"
  • Depth: 3.3"
  • Weight: 1.06 lbs.
  • Manufacturer Part Number: NC-200

Great, cutting edge pedal
I had a Logidy Epsi convolution reverb pedal that I loved but it wasn't great for live use since it was hard to adjust on the fly. It also did not have an IR capture function built in, nor a screen to see IR names. The Verbera solves all this, and adds more functionality. First, I just did a capture of the spring tank in my old Deluxe Reverb II, which has a line out to make it easier. The capture "clone" process from the Verbera was super quick, and sounds identical to the spring tank. Be aware that you can't clone shimmer reverbs, but the pedal does have a really useful and good sounding modulation function to apply to reverbs. The freeze function is great and the way the pedal is set up to step up/down presets is well-implemented. All this said, there are a few niggles with this pedal: 1) the Neon Collector software from Hotone does not offer full programing of the pedal and has a clunky way of storing to/from the pedal. Hotone really needs to improve this software. 2) The current draw is high at 1A, so either use the supplied power wart, or make sure your pedal power supply is capable of supplying requisite current. 3) The lights on the pedal cannot be dimmed or turned off. Perhaps this could be part of a future firmware update. In any case, this is several steps up from the Logidy Epsi. Overall, an excellent device.
